As a whole, the US is fat, but Mississippi was the most overweight state in the nation in 2018, according to a new report.
At the other end of the spectrum, Utah and Colorado scored the lowest on the obesity scale in WalletHub’s new analysis.
By its three measures – prevalence of obesity and people who are overweight, related health problems and the foods and fitness routines of residents – states in the South consistently ranked as the ones where weight was the biggest problem.
